Contrary to rumors, Huawei unveils MateStation B515 desktop computer based on AMD chip instead of ARM

Today, November 21, a publication with information about the MateStation B515 desktop PC appeared on the official website of Huawei. The kit, in addition to the actual system unit, includes a monitor, a keyboard with a fingerprint scanner, and a computer mouse. And the heart will be a chip from AMD.

Huawei MateStation
Huawei MateStation

Earlier, we wrote about rumors that the computer will be built on the 7nm ARM processor Kunpeng 920 (D920S10), developed in the HiSilicon division. Apparently, the company felt that the Windows computer market was not yet quite ready for this kind of change, so the MateStation B515 was based on AMD chips. In total, two modifications are available – with an AMD Ryzen 5 4600G or AMD Ryzen 7 4700G processor. Both options will use integrated Radeon graphics.

The amount of RAM varies from 8 to 16 GB of DDR4 type. For data storage, there is a combination of M.2 SSD with a volume of 256 or 512 GB and a 1 TB hard drive. Bluetooth 5.0 and Wi-Fi 802.11ac modules are, of course, available. The operating system is Windows 10 Home with preinstalled programs from Huawei, including Huawei Share, which allows you to quickly exchange files with Huawei smartphones over a wireless connection and launch mobile applications from a smartphone on a computer.

The computer comes with a 23.8-inch FullHD IPS monitor, a keyboard with a built-in fingerprint reader, connected via USB, and a wired mouse. Pricing and launch date have not yet been announced.
